Pictures of the Week 17 to 23 May 2014: Best Photos of Past Seven Days

A selection of photographs, covering a range of topics from the Vivid Sydney light and music festival to flooding in Obrenovac

dinosaur bone
A girl lies on the fossilised femur of a dinosaur at the Egidio Feruglio Museum in Trelew, Argentina. Scientists said the dinosaur could be 130 feet long and 65 feet tall, and weigh at 85 tons, and it is a previously undiscovered species of titanosaur, a herbivore, which lived during the Late Cretaceous period Reuters

superga
A Benfica fan wears face paint depicting the Superga air disaster during the UEFA Europa League Final match against Sevilla at Juventus Stadium in Turin. On 4 May 1949 a plane carrying almost the entire Torino AC football team crashed into Superga Hill near Turin, killing all 31 people aboard AFP
